Since Cut2D Desktop only allows 60 x 60 cm projects, I figured I would divide my wasteboard in several sections when drilling holes for insert nuts. After finishing the holes in the first section, measuring about 44 X 44 cm and illustrated in grey in the image attached, I proceeded with the next section, illustrated in white in the attached image. Seemed fairly easy to do. But the columns are now showing up misaligned as per the image attached. BLACK circles represent the file in Vectric Cut2D, BLUE filled circles have been cut already, RED filled circles represent where the machine is now cutting). Not only that, the alignment error grows from left to right (X-Axis of machine) until it reaches a difference of about 0.5 cm in the rightmost column. I have triple-checked all measurements in Vectric and everything is correct. I have measured the deviation in the X-Axis and the difference I found in 78 cm is only 0.2 cm which I don't think would account for such a large difference. What is going on?

No, they are fine in the preview. It's in the cut that they get out of wack. Meanwhile I checked the X-axis motor coupler and the collar clamp wasn't properly tightened so I think the X lead screw has been slipping. This might be what was causing the issue. I have properly secured the collar clamp but have yet to test with a new cutting.
